What is sports accounting?

Sports accounting involves payroll and budget management for the operations of a sports team. Some sports accountants work directly for a sports franchise, while other accounting professionals may operate independently and contract with teams who need assistance with specific aspects of their financial balance sheets. As a sports accountant, your responsibilities include ensuring your clients comply with all accounting regulations and practices and maintaining proper bookkeeping. Your duties may also change based on the season. For example, in the offseason, sports accountants often help a team’s front office determine how much they can spend on new players.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a sports accountant,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Sports Accountant, you need a strong background in accounting principles, financial analysis, and a relevant degree such as a bachelor's in accounting or finance, often complemented by a CPA certification. Familiarity with sports industry-specific accounting software, ERP systems, and compliance tools is typically required. Exceptional attention to detail, integrity, and effective communication skills help you manage complex transactions and collaborate with diverse stakeholders. These competencies ensure accurate financial reporting, regulatory compliance, and effective financial management within the fast-paced sports industry.

How does a sports accountant typically collaborate with coaches and management teams within an athletic organization?

Sports accountants frequently work closely with coaches, team managers, and executives to track budgets, analyze financial performance, and ensure compliance with league regulations. They may participate in regular meetings to review spending on player contracts, travel, and equipment, offering insights to support financial decision-making. Effective communication and a strong understanding of sports operations are essential, as accountants often translate complex financial data into actionable information for non-financial staff.

What is the difference between Sports Accounting vs Sports Finance?

AspectSports AccountingSports Finance
Required CredentialsAccounting certifications (e.g., CPA), finance knowledgeFinance certifications (e.g., CFA), financial analysis skills
Work EnvironmentSports organizations, accounting firms, clubsSports teams, financial consulting firms, agencies
Employer & Industry UsageUsed for managing budgets, taxes, and compliance in sportsUsed for investment analysis, financial planning, and funding in sports

Sports Accounting focuses on managing financial records, taxes, and compliance within sports organizations. Sports Finance involves analyzing investments, budgeting, and financial planning for sports entities. While both roles require financial expertise, Sports Accounting emphasizes record-keeping and regulatory adherence, whereas Sports Finance centers on strategic financial decision-making.
